A highly versatile midweight fleece, The North Face Pumori Fleece Jacket for men is one of the most indispensable items for year-round outdoor adventures. Some fleece are too thick for summer backpacking, other fleece is too thin for anything except middle layering, but the Pumori is just right with midweight Polartec® 200 Series fleece. You can wear it as a middle layer in the winter (it is zip-in compatible and zips into other jackets made by The North Face--just remember to pick the same size) or wear it as outerwear on camping trips. The one thing that the Pumori Jacket doesn't have is the nylon reinforcement panels along the shoulders like the slightly heavier Denali Jackets by The North Face. That means that if you backpack or climb extensively with a pack, you may notice minor pilling and wear abrasion beneath the straps.

A classic, eco friendly North Face fleece jacket that is appealing in its enduring style. Made from 200 weight recycled Polartech fleece, The North Face Pumori jacket is a versatile mid weight fleece jacket for urban adventures or a nice warm layer for all around explorations in colder climates.

Go green when you throw on The North Face(r) Pumori men's fleece jacket. This standard fit fleece is constructed using recycled materials, including 90% post-industrial and 10% post-consumer. You can zip this fleece into your compatible shell jacket for additional warmth.

I'll start this review and share that I received the coat for Christmas '09 so I can't offer up the type of review I like to read about the wear and tear and durability of outer gear...not simply...it looks nice and feels good...which it does.

With that being said, after much research this jacket was purchased because its made from polartec materials which I love. This jacket is replacing a 12 year old Columbia polartec that finally bit the bullet after being used as a layer on many daily freezing cycling, running and hiking excursions.

Things I like about this jacket include,,,,warm, but not overly bulky, zip down side pockets to open, elastic draw string pulls on both sides of coat and the inch of fabric that extends past the zipper to ensure no wind blows through zipper.

The Pumori is a Polartec 200 series fleece. No, it's neither windproof nor waterproof. It's a 200 fleece!! It's lightweight, not too thick and has the cuff snaps and zipper which will allow it to be attached to any North Face shell that permits it. You can layer under it if you want but I think that it works best as the underlayer of a shell. The Pumori has been around a long time and will probably continue to be because it just works.

Zips in perfectly to same-sized TNF shell to form a very warm coat. Only complaint is when zipped together there is no zip-able inner pocket (the fleece jacket has two deep but open inside pockets).
